Linyati Walking Safari

The Linyanti Swamps, adjacent to the Chobe National Park, offers a pristine wilderness environment and is known for its rewarding walking trails. You follow the game on foot, accompanied by a professional guide and a tracker. The luggage is moved each day while you are out walking. A wild, yet truly memorable safari experience.

Day 1 : Depart Maun for 1 night Selinda Camp, Fully Inclusive
On arrival at Maun, you are met and transferred by light aircraft to Selinda camp in the Linyanti Swamps. The Swamps lie to the west of the Chobe National Park, wilder and more remote. It’s particularly known for the huge concentrations of elephant, which can reach enormous densities during the winter months. The landscape is characterized by grassland vistas dotted with palm forest islands – all very picturesque and open. Selinda Lodge is situated on the banks of the eastern Selinda spillway among shaded riverine forest overlooking the Selinda floodplains in the Linyanti Reserve. The camp is very small and intimate, accommodating only 12 guests in large, airy, well-appointed Meru tents.

Day 2 : 2 nights, Trail camps, Fully Inclusive
Today is the start of your walking safari with 2 nights spent in trail camps of Mokaba and Tshwene. You walk through open floodplains dotted with riparian forest and palm islands. Each day you walk approximately 7km in the morning between the trails camps. After lunch and a siesta you enjoy approximately 3km of casual walking in the vicinity of the trails camp. The camps offer comfortable accommodation - the canvas Meru tents have proper beds, an adjacent flush toilet, solar lighting and storage space. Traditional bucket showers.

Day 4 : 2 nights, Zibalianja Camp, Fully Inclusive
The walking tour ends at Zibalianja Camp. Zibalianja Camp is a charming six bed tented camp on a palm-fringed island overlooking the Zibalianja Lagoon and the open floodplains. Your large airy Meru-style tent is on a raised wooden deck with en suite open-air facilities and solar power. Morning and afternoon drives are complemented by the excitement of a night drive in search of nocturnal predators. Other activities by arrangement include game viewing by boat on the lagoon, fishing and walking.

Day 6 : Return to Maun
Today, after a final early morning game activity and brunch, you fly back to Maun. Alternatively you could fly to Kasane and travel onto Victoria Falls for a small extra cost.
